I’m kinda bias on the subject of Stat Reset potions. I thought about it being available for each character only one time, but even one time is too much for an unlimited amount of lvl’s.

So what if Stat Reset Potions, if they ever to be implemented, were to reset not all of your stats but fixed amount of stats by your choice per potion.

Explanation:
- Have different types of stat reset options, like STR Reset Potion, CON Reset Potion, etc.
- Each potion has a set number of points that it can recover from a certain stat.(10-20 would be enoug I think. This won’t allow people to completly change their build other night. Like to go from DD to Support)
- Each pot can have a ridiculous amount of cooldown time. Like a week or something(I don’t know).
- Different stat pots won’t be affected by cooldown, if you used one of them(like if you used Dex Reset Potion you can still use SPR Reset Potion).
- Or the bought potions can be used only in the range of 20-50 lvl’s from the lvl. they have been bought.(If you bought a potion at lvl.100 you can’t use at lvl. 121/151)
/this one is a bit over the top/

These are some thoughts I had tonight about this issue, you’re welcome to critisize it/add to it/completly disagree with it/whatever else you want do with it.
